What Are Inlays and Onlays?
Inlays and onlays are types of indirect dental restorations that are crafted outside of the mouth and then bonded to the tooth. They’re often referred to as “partial crowns” and are made from durable materials like porcelain or composite resin.
- Inlays: Fit within the grooves of the tooth (similar to a large filling).
- Onlays: Extend over one or more cusps (points) of the tooth to cover more surface area.
These restorations are typically recommended when a dental filling isn’t strong enough, but a dental crown would remove too much healthy tooth structure.
Benefits of Inlays and Onlays
Inlays and onlays provide several advantages:
- Preserve more of your natural tooth than crowns
- Stronger and longer-lasting than traditional fillings
- Highly aesthetic—color-matched to your natural tooth
- Resistant to wear, staining, and fracture
- Custom-made for a perfect fit

What to Expect from the Inlay or Onlay Procedure
Treatment typically involves two visits to our Baltimore office:
- Initial Visit and Tooth Preparation: Dr. Desbordes removes the damaged or decayed portion of the tooth and takes digital impressions using advanced scanning technology.
- Restoration Placement: Your custom inlay or onlay is fabricated in a dental lab, then bonded to the tooth during your second visit. We ensure a precise fit and polish the surface for a smooth, natural finish.
This procedure offers excellent durability while keeping more of your natural tooth intact than a full crown.

Are inlays and onlays better than fillings?
Yes—especially for larger cavities or damage. Inlays and onlays are stronger, last longer, and provide a more precise fit than traditional fillings.
How long do inlays and onlays last?
With good care, they can last 10–15 years or more. They’re highly durable and resistant to wear and staining.
Is the procedure painful?
Not at all. The area is numbed before treatment, and most patients report little to no discomfort during or after the procedure.

What materials are used?
We use high-quality porcelain or composite resin for their strength and natural appearance. These materials are color-matched to your surrounding teeth.
